GSK India Targets ₹8,000 Crore Revenue Milestone by FY30

· Business · Business Standard, Economic Times

GlaxoSmithKline Pharmaceuticals India aims to double its annual revenue to ₹8,000 crore by the end of the 2030 financial year. Managing Director Bhushan Akshikar stated the company plans to achieve this growth by expanding its presence in key therapeutic segments, including vaccines and specialty medicines. The strategy involves strengthening the company's portfolio in areas such as respiratory, shingles, and meningitis vaccines. GSK India intends to leverage its existing distribution network to increase market penetration across the country. The company's leadership remains focused on long-term growth despite competitive pressures in the domestic pharmaceutical sector.

Why it matters

This growth target signals a significant expansion for one of India's major multinational pharmaceutical players, potentially increasing the availability of specialized vaccines and treatments for Indian patients.
